
凝思系统的java版本如何固定
用户关注问题
如何确保凝思系统中使用的Java版本稳定?
我想在凝思系统中使用特定的Java版本,避免因版本升级导致兼容性问题,应该怎么操作?
在凝思系统中锁定Java版本的办法
要保证凝思系统使用固定的Java版本,需在系统配置中明确指定Java运行环境路径。此外,可以通过设置环境变量JAVA_HOME指向所需版本的安装目录,并在启动脚本中硬编码此路径,以防止系统自动切换至其他版本。确保所有相关服务和构建工具也同步应用该版本设置。
凝思系统如何避免Java版本自动升级导致的问题?
系统自动升级Java可能会引发应用异常,有什么方法可以阻止这个过程吗?
防止Java版本自动升级的措施
应关闭操作系统或包管理工具中Java相关的自动更新功能。例如,在Linux系统中可锁定Java包版本或从更新列表中排除Java。使用内部版本管理工具时,确保配置文件中明确版本号,不使用动态版本标识。通过这些方法,可以避免Java版本被非预期地升级。
在凝思系统中,如何检测当前运行的Java版本?
我需要确认凝思系统实际调用的Java版本,是否有便捷的检查方法?
查看凝思系统Java版本的步骤
可以通过命令行执行java -version,查看当前默认Java版本。若凝思系统采用特定启动脚本运行Java程序,也可查看脚本中指定的JAVA_HOME或java路径。此外,检查应用的日志文件,有时会记录启动时使用的Java版本信息。结合这些方式能准确确认正在使用的Java版本。